The following are some considerations to think about.

 

Music

Many memorial services rely on music to set the tone, fill silences, and comfort mourners. Don’t think you have to listen to only sad music. Make a playlist of songs that the person liked, or use music that speaks to the person’s personality or interests. You could also have people sing or play instruments.

 

Slideshows or Videos

Slideshows or videos are an excellent visual way to relive special memories, and they frequently serve as an excellent substitute for a eulogy if no one can get through a short speech. Combine amusing, meaningful images and video clips with music that will help the audience remember the deceased. For those who were unable to attend the service, memorial videos can be shared online.

 

Speakers

Whom do you want to address the congregation at the service? You can have a religious speaker communicate, but you may also want one or more loved ones to give a brief eulogy. Inquire with people you know who cared deeply about the person and may have something unique to share.

 

Arrangement for an Altar or Urn

The casket is usually the focal point of a funeral. You decide what role the cremated remains should play at a post-cremation memorial service. You can make an altar out of pictures and special mementos, or place the urn on a simple table.

 

List of Who Should Attend

Make a list of everyone you want to invite to a private memorial service, including their names, addresses, and other contact information. Consider posting information in an obituary or online profile if you are planning a more public event and want to ensure that anyone who may have cared for the person has a chance to attend.

 

Food Service

Consider whether you want the memorial service catered, if you want participants to bring a dish to share, or if you want to go out afterward to a restaurant that was meaningful to your loved one. The last option may be preferable for a small, private gathering; if you are expecting a large number of guests, make sure to notify dining establishments in advance.

 

Arrangements of Flowers
